Inspiring Lives-42: "Always Remembered"

Children's Day is the birthday of Jawaharlal Nehru. He loved children and wished that they shone like the twinkling stars of the sky and rose to lofty heights. He wanted to eliminate the curse of poverty, ignorance, unemployment and disease. He did not want to rest till his last breath. Though he is not with us today, he cannot be forgotten by any child in the world.
